Funds in bank for extension based on marriage


Recommended Posts

Good day,

I intend to apply for the extension based on marriage.

I understand that there must be at least THB400,000 in my Thai bank account for 2 months before the extension can be processed.

My question is; if the money is in the bank more than 2 months before the application will that speed up the process.

I want to deposit the funds now but only apply in December and can probably only stay in Thailand for 6 weeks or so before having to return to my home country. I hope this request makes sense.

Thank you.

The money has to be in the bank 2 months before the date of the extension application. If it has been sitting in the account for a longer time it doesn't change anything.

The date of application for the extension is what it is about.

Thank you, assuming the required amount has been in the account for plus 2 months how long dies it normally take for the application to be processed/approved?

When your application is accepted you be given a under consideration stamp. It will have a report back date 30 days from the date you apply or from the date your current permit to stay ends dependent upon where you apply for the extension.
